#4f7b4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f7b4d is composed of 31% red, 48.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 117.4 degrees, a saturation of 23% and a lightness of 39.2%. #4f7b4d color hex could be obtained by blending #9ef69a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#4f7b4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f7b4d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6c5c is the less saturated color, while #09c800 is the most saturated one.
